提交 6006ba8f 编写于 作者: VK1688's avatar VK1688

1.8.1

上级 3cfdd87b
* 1、【升级】`vk-unicloud-admin-ui` 包升级至 `1.8.2`
* 2、【升级】`element-ui` 包升级至 `2.15.7`
* 3、【新增】自 `1.8.0` 起,支持自定义主题,内置纯白、纯黑、黑白3个主题,同时支持编写自定义主题。[点击查看主题说明](https://vkdoc.fsq.pub/admin/1/theme.html)
* 4、【优化】主题细节。
##### 框架更新步骤 [点击查看](https://vkdoc.fsq.pub/admin/1/update.html)
##### 框架学习Q群:`22466457` 欢迎萌新和大佬来使用和共同改进框架
##### 如果你觉得框架对你有用,可以在下方进行评论,也可以进行赞赏。
## 1.8.1(2021-12-01)
* 1、【升级】`vk-unicloud-admin-ui` 包升级至 `1.8.2`
* 2、【升级】`element-ui` 包升级至 `2.15.7`
* 3、【新增】自 `1.8.0` 起,支持自定义主题,内置纯白、纯黑、黑白3个主题,同时支持编写自定义主题。[点击查看主题说明](https://vkdoc.fsq.pub/admin/1/theme.html)
* 4、【优化】主题细节。
##### 框架更新步骤 [点击查看](https://vkdoc.fsq.pub/admin/1/update.html)
##### 框架学习Q群:`22466457` 欢迎萌新和大佬来使用和共同改进框架
##### 如果你觉得框架对你有用,可以在下方进行评论,也可以进行赞赏。
## 1.8.0(2021-11-30)
* 1、【升级】`vk-unicloud-admin-ui` 包升级至 `1.8.1`
* 2、【新增】自 `1.8.0` 起,支持自定义主题,内置纯白、纯黑、黑白3个主题,同时支持编写自定义主题。[点击查看主题说明](https://vkdoc.fsq.pub/admin/1/theme.html)
......
......@@ -8,7 +8,8 @@ export default {
activeTextColor: "#ffffff",
activeBackgroundColor: "#2d8cf0",
hoverTextColor: "#ffffff",
hoverBackgroundColor: "#545f6c"
hoverBackgroundColor: "#545f6c",
boxShadow: "2px 0 6px rgba(0,21,4,0.2)"
},
// 顶部菜单样式
topMenu: {
......
......@@ -8,7 +8,8 @@ export default {
activeTextColor: "#ffffff",
activeBackgroundColor: "#2d8cf0",
hoverTextColor: "#ffffff",
hoverBackgroundColor: "#545f6c"
hoverBackgroundColor: "#545f6c",
boxShadow: "2px 0 6px rgba(0,21,4,0.25)"
},
// 顶部菜单样式
topMenu: {
......
......@@ -8,11 +8,12 @@ export default {
activeTextColor: "#409EFF",
activeBackgroundColor: "#ecf5ff",
hoverTextColor: "#303133",
hoverBackgroundColor: "#efefef"
hoverBackgroundColor: "#efefef",
boxShadow: "2px 0 8px 0 rgba(29,35,41,0.05)"
},
// 顶部菜单样式
topMenu: {
backgroundColor: "#ffffff",
textColor: "#999999",
}
}
\ No newline at end of file
}
{
"name": "vk-unicloud-admin",
"version": "1.7.4",
"version": "1.8.0",
"lockfileVersion": 1,
"requires": true,
"dependencies": {
......@@ -37,9 +37,9 @@
"integrity": "sha512-95k0GDqvBjZavkuvzx/YqVLv/6YYa17fz6ILMSf7neqQITCPbnfEnQvEgMPNjH4kgobe7+WIL0yJEHku+H3qtQ=="
},
"element-ui": {
"version": "2.15.6",
"resolved": "https://registry.npmjs.org/element-ui/-/element-ui-2.15.6.tgz",
"integrity": "sha512-rcYXEKd/j2G0AgficAOk1Zd1AsnHRkhmrK4yLHmNOiimU2JfsywgfKUjMoFuT6pQx0luhovj8lFjpE4Fnt58Iw==",
"version": "2.15.7",
"resolved": "https://registry.npmjs.org/element-ui/-/element-ui-2.15.7.tgz",
"integrity": "sha512-+J6rnXajxzLwV6w8Q6bf7Yqzk1FO1ewbIrCy/4B5alnd7tj8WEpfQoAvISirVaUGVGy77d9Ji3o2bF4f0AsJLQ==",
"requires": {
"async-validator": "~1.8.1",
"babel-helper-vue-jsx-merge-props": "^2.0.0",
......@@ -104,9 +104,9 @@
}
},
"vk-unicloud-admin-ui": {
"version": "1.8.1",
"resolved": "https://registry.npmjs.org/vk-unicloud-admin-ui/-/vk-unicloud-admin-ui-1.8.1.tgz",
"integrity": "sha512-cLbAPgWrmAMtCrHXg3JgHkrsVOpeih9uqeD2XcWQp6K0oBOgxhdcYXvm45vXF++5nNgFtUvwg5hfF6n+OEYZnw=="
"version": "1.8.2",
"resolved": "https://registry.npmjs.org/vk-unicloud-admin-ui/-/vk-unicloud-admin-ui-1.8.2.tgz",
"integrity": "sha512-DMLL7ib8ygtzPd3e2LH8/6sx7aF4cuA3Wi1+QmsQ2oTarCtNaKIz10LAa+6KhO9tR+voRfKiN/H6Z/c9/YrdhQ=="
},
"vuedraggable": {
"version": "2.24.3",
......
{
"id": "vk-unicloud-admin",
"name": "vk-unicloud-admin",
"version": "1.8.0",
"version": "1.8.1",
"displayName": "【开箱即用】vk-unicloud-admin-快速开发框架-打造unicloud最好用的admin",
"description": "vk-unicloud-admin是基于unicloud+uni-id+element+vk-unicloud-router的一套快速PC admin完整开发框架。小白几分钟即可完成一个页面CRUD。",
"keywords": [
......@@ -20,9 +20,9 @@
"license": "Apache",
"homepage": "https://vkdoc.fsq.pub/admin/",
"dependencies": {
"element-ui": "^2.15.6",
"element-ui": "^2.15.7",
"umy-ui": "^1.1.6",
"vk-unicloud-admin-ui": "^1.8.1"
"vk-unicloud-admin-ui": "^1.8.2"
},
"engines": {
"HBuilderX": "^3.1.10"
......
<template>
<scroll-view class="sidebar" :class="vk.getVuex('$app.isPC') ? 'pc' : 'mobile'" scroll-y="true" v-loading="!vk.getVuex('$app.inited')" :style="'background-color:'+backgroundColor">
<scroll-view class="sidebar" :class="vk.getVuex('$app.isPC') ? 'pc' : 'mobile'" scroll-y="true" v-loading="!vk.getVuex('$app.inited')"
:style="{
backgroundColor:backgroundColor,
boxShadow:boxShadow
}"
>
<vk-data-menu-nav
v-if="vk.getVuex('$app.inited')"
:data="vk.getVuex('$app.navMenu')"
......@@ -46,6 +51,14 @@
} else {
return "#ffffff";
}
},
boxShadow(){
let theme = this.theme;
if (theme && theme.use) {
return theme[theme.use].leftMenu.boxShadow;
} else {
return "2px 0 6px rgba(0,21,4,0.2)";
}
}
}
}
......@@ -58,7 +71,8 @@
width: 240px;
height: calc(100vh - (var(--window-top)) + 50px);
box-sizing: border-box;
border-right: 1px solid darken($left-window-bg-color, 3%);
box-shadow: var(--boxShadow);
box-shadow: 2px 0 8px 0 rgba(29,35,41,0.05);
background-color: $left-window-bg-color;
padding-bottom: 10px;
top: 50px;
......
......@@ -226,11 +226,11 @@ export default {
color: $top-window-text-color;
/* 左侧 */
.left {
width: calc(var(--window-left) - 2px);
width: calc(var(--window-left));
}
/* 右侧 */
.right {
width: calc(100% - var(--window-left) + 2px);
width: calc(100% - var(--window-left));
.navbar {
font-size: 13px;
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册